Regarded as the “Queen City of the Rockies,” Helena is Montana’s capital city, rich with history, activity, and stunning natural views. Helena’s past and present converge in Last Chance Gulch, where prospectors initially struck it rich in 1864. Last Chance Gulch now contains Helena’s downtown area, brimming with eclectic boutiques, delectable restaurants, local breweries, and cozy coffee shops.
Situated halfway between Glacier National Park and Yellowstone National Park, Helena is teeming with opportunities for outdoor recreation. Hiking and biking options are especially plentiful in Helena, with over 75 miles of trails that begin in the downtown area. Helena is also known as Montana’s geocaching capital. Convenience to Interstate 15 makes getting around from Helena simple.
